Addison Gallery-American Art

180 Main St, Andover 01810, Massachusetts United States

180 Main St Andover, Massachusetts 01810 United States

Ratings & Review

Uh oh! We couldn't find any review for this listing.
Post Review

Business Details

: (978)749-4025

Popular Listings